The annual World Naked Bike Ride wound its way across Brooklyn and Lower Manhattan yesterday. And no one was arrested this year for causing a ruckus of rosy cheeks in the streets.
That's probably because this was a decidedly low-key event this year—there were only around 15-20 people who painted their bodies and participated in the ride, with another 15 or so photographers in tow. The event got started late in the hope that more riders would turn out.
More shockingly, there was very little nudity anywhere to be seen— only a few of the riders were mostly naked (down to their underwear). The vast majority had shorts on. No one went completely naked.
